How long does a Brazilian wax last?
On average, about 3–6 weeks. We recommend rebooking every 4 weeks for the smoothest results and easy upkeep.
Is it okay to get waxed during my period?
Yes, you can get waxed on your period as long as you wear a fresh tampon or cup. Just know that the area might feel slightly more sensitive during this time.
What’s the difference between a Brazilian wax and a bikini wax?
A Brazilian wax removes all, or most of the hair from the front, butt-strip, and everything in between. A Bikini Full wax does the same, but without the butt-strip. A Bikini Line wax focuses on the sides and maybe a finger or two off the top only — what would show in a standard swimsuit.
How do I prepare for my first wax appointment?
Let your hair grow to at least 1/4 inch (about the length of a grain of rice). Exfoliate 24 hours before, and skip caffeine the day of to help reduce sensitivity.
Does waxing hurt more than shaving?
Waxing can cause momentary discomfort, but it generally removes the hair from the root—so you stay smoother way longer than shaving.
Plus, it gets easier with consistency!
What type of wax do you use?
I use high-quality hard wax — no strips involved. It’s gentle on the skin and perfect for even the most sensitive areas like Brazilians, underarms, and the face.
Can I get a wax if I just shaved recently?
Not quite yet — your hair needs to be at least 1/4 inch long (about the length of a grain of rice) for the wax to grip properly. This is usually around 2–3 weeks of growth after shaving. The longer the better for your first time — it helps ensure a more effective wax and smoother results.
How should I care for my skin after waxing?
Keep the area clean, dry, and avoid heat, friction, and heavy workouts for the first 24–48 hours. I also recommend exfoliating regularly and moisturizing to help prevent ingrowns and keep your hair strong between appointments.
Do you offer vajacials or post-wax treatments?
Yes! I offer post-wax treatments like vajacials that are especially great for those prone to ingrown hairs. They soothe skin, reduce irritation, and help you get the smoothest, clearest finish possible.
How long should I wait between wax appointments?
Facial areas and underarms are typically rebooked every 2 weeks, but can sometimes be pushed to 3 weeks depending on hair growth. Most other body areas are best maintained on a 4-week schedule, but you can stretch to 5–6 weeks if needed.
